LIANE DAVEY, PhD, is a Principal of Knightsbridge Human Capital Solutions, Inc. and the Vice President for Global Solutions and Team Effectiveness. She is sought out by executives at some of North America's leading financial services, consumer goods, high-tech, and healthcare organizations to rehabilitate teams that have become toxic and to work with healthy teams that want to take their performance to the next level. A dynamic keynote speaker, Liane takes her message about vital teams to leaders at conferences and management retreats around the world.She is the coauthor of Leadership Solutions .
